On this date in 1429, Joan of Arc arrived at Orleans and entered the
city. Her arrival began the unraveling of the English siege. The rescue
of Orleans was the first major French victory since the debacle at
Agincourt in 1415, and shifted the advantage to the French for the
remainder of the Hundred Years War:
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Siege_of_Orléans . Yes the Scots were
there with the Maiden. Her vanguard included a significant number of
Scottish archers and men-at-arms.
